Burmese Pork Hot Pot in Sangkhlaburi: A Flavor That Blends Two Cultures on the Food Street

Hello, I am mr.hotsia, here to share the story of Burmese pork hot pot in Sangkhlaburi, a charming small town by the Songkalia River, rich with diverse cultures blending harmoniously. The pork hot pot here is not just an ordinary dish but an experience that tells the story of Burmese and Thai people living together on the bustling street food scene at night.

I arrived in Sangkhlaburi in the evening. The riverside atmosphere was peaceful yet lively with dimly lit street food stalls. The aroma of spices and Burmese pork hot pot broth greeted me as soon as I stepped into the night market. The Burmese pork hot pot is distinguished by its rich broth, perfectly balanced spicy flavor, and fresh ingredients displayed for selection, including a variety of fresh vegetables and well-marinated pork.

What makes Burmese pork hot pot in Sangkhlaburi different from elsewhere is the use of local herbs and seasonings passed down through generations. It is clear that the food here is not adjusted to general taste standards but retains the authentic traditional flavors of the Burmese people completely.

Strolling Through the Market and Border Life

Sangkhlaburi is a town located next to the Myanmar border, giving it a unique atmosphere and culture. I walked past shops and street markets, seeing Thai and Mon people blending harmoniously. Shopping and conversations in various languages made me feel like experiencing a small corner of Myanmar close to home.

Burmese pork hot pot here is as popular as other local dishes. I sat down at a small shop owned by a genuine Burmese owner, served with pork hot pot, hot sticky rice, and a special dipping sauce that perfectly complements the pork and broth flavors.

Tips for Those Wanting to Try Burmese Pork Hot Pot in Sangkhlaburi

For me, mr.hotsia, who travels for real, tasting Burmese pork hot pot in Sangkhlaburi is not just about flavor but about experiencing the culture, lifestyle, and warmth of the people here.

If you visit here, I recommend coming in the evening when the market is lively and the food is fresh. Most shops use charcoal grills, giving a unique aroma. Don't forget to try various dipping sauces, as each vendor has their special recipe, adding variety and making your meal more enjoyable and delicious.

Traveling to Sangkhlaburi from Thailand is convenient with various buses and rental vehicles. If you enjoy nature trips, I suggest renting a motorcycle to explore the area fully and experience the charm of this town.
